The ONSEMI PNP Bipolar RF Transistor is precisely designed for general radio frequency amplifier and mixer applications. Operating effectively at transition frequencies up to 600MHz, this transistor supports collector currents in the 1 to 30mA range, making it highly suitable for a variety of low-power RF circuit designs and communication systems.
Featuring a compact SOT-23 surface mount package with 3 pins, this component allows for efficient use of printed circuit board space. It offers a maximum collector-emitter voltage of 20V and a collector-base voltage of 20V, with an emitter-base voltage of 3V. The device provides a continuous collector current of -50mA and a power dissipation of 225mW, ensuring reliable performance in demanding electronic environments.
With a DC current gain (hFE) of 60 and a maximum operating temperature of 150°C, this PNP RF transistor delivers consistent and stable operation. The product dimensions are 43 mm in height, 33 mm in width, and 15 mm in depth, with a weight of 110 grams for the packaged unit.
